The state, named after explorer Cândido Rondon, offers a diverse range of experiences for any traveler. From the bustling capital city of Porto Velho, bathed by the Madeira River, to the picturesque towns of Ariquemes, Cacoal, and Ji-Paraná, each brims with unique charm and hospitality. With its vast area, Rondônia offers a delightful itinerary for discovering its 52 municipalities, boasting an array of cultural, historical, and natural attractions.

Rondônia, once home to over 200,000 km of rainforest, has witnessed the evolution of its landscape due to deforestation and development. As one of the most deforested places in the Amazon, it is an intriguing destination for travelers interested in environmental conservation and sustainable tourism. The state's economy, driven by agriculture, livestock, and mineral extraction, reflects its progress and transformation into a major agricultural frontier in Brazil.
